Determination of the concentration of sodium hydroxide by titration with a calibrated HCl solution of 0.10 mol/L.
Learning to handle volumetric material: volumetric flask, pipette, pipette pump, burette.
Determine the concentration of sodium hydroxide by titration with a calibrated HCl solution of 0.10 mol/L. The NaOH solution is provided.
Principle of titration and of acid-base indicators.
Materiaal (Materials): burette, stand, burette clamp, 250 mL Erlenmeyer flask, 100 mL graduated cylinder, 10 mL pipette, funnel, white card as background.
Stoffen (Substances):
Phenolphthalein, distilled water
NaOH solution H 315-319 P 280.1+3-305+351+338
HCl solution 0.10 mol/L – no H- and P-sentences
Pipette exactly 10 mL of the NaOH solution into an Erlenmeyer flask, add a few drops of phenolphthalein, and homogenize.
Fill the burette with the 0.10 mol/L HCl solution.
Record the initial reading of the HCl solution in the burette.
Titrate until colorless.
Record the final reading of the HCl solution in the burette.
Perform the titration at least three times and calculate the average added volume.
Let the burette drain. Rinse by letting a full burette of tap water drain through.
